Oxfam OIYP
OIYP is the Oxfam International Youth Partnership program. It is made up of 300 young people, aged 18-25 from around the world, who are called Action Partners.  As young people committed to a positive and equitable world, they are working for peaceful, equitable and sustainable social change in a range of different contexts. OIYP works in all regions of the world.
